[PATCH] D136175: [BasicAA] Include MayBeCrossIteration in cache key

Index: llvm/lib/Analysis/BasicAliasAnalysis.cpp
===================================================================
--- llvm/lib/Analysis/BasicAliasAnalysis.cpp
+++ llvm/lib/Analysis/BasicAliasAnalysis.cpp
@@ -1403,14 +1403,8 @@
   // different loop iterations.
   SaveAndRestore<bool> SavedMayBeCrossIteration(MayBeCrossIteration, true);
 
-  // If we enabled the MayBeCrossIteration flag, alias analysis results that
-  // have been cached earlier may no longer be valid. Perform recursive queries
-  // with a new AAQueryInfo.
-  AAQueryInfo NewAAQI = AAQI.withEmptyCache();
-  AAQueryInfo *UseAAQI = !SavedMayBeCrossIteration.get() ? &NewAAQI : &AAQI;
-
   AliasResult Alias = AAQI.AAR.alias(MemoryLocation(V1Srcs[0], PNSize),
-                                     MemoryLocation(V2, V2Size), *UseAAQI);
+                                     MemoryLocation(V2, V2Size), AAQI);
 
   // Early exit if the check of the first PHI source against V2 is MayAlias.
   // Other results are not possible.
@@ -1427,7 +1421,7 @@
     Value *V = V1Srcs[i];
 
     AliasResult ThisAlias = AAQI.AAR.alias(
-        MemoryLocation(V, PNSize), MemoryLocation(V2, V2Size), *UseAAQI);
+        MemoryLocation(V, PNSize), MemoryLocation(V2, V2Size), AAQI);
     Alias = MergeAliasResults(ThisAlias, Alias);
     if (Alias == AliasResult::MayAlias)
       break;
@@ -1544,8 +1538,11 @@
     return AliasResult::MayAlias;
 
   // Check the cache before climbing up use-def chains. This also terminates
-  // otherwise infinitely recursive queries.
-  AAQueryInfo::LocPair Locs({V1, V1Size}, {V2, V2Size});
+  // otherwise infinitely recursive queries. Include MayBeCrossIteration in the
+  // cache key, because some cases where MayBeCrossIteration==false returns
+  // MustAlias or NoAlias may become MayAlias under MayBeCrossIteration==true.
+  AAQueryInfo::LocPair Locs({V1, V1Size, MayBeCrossIteration},
+                            {V2, V2Size, MayBeCrossIteration});
   const bool Swapped = V1 > V2;
   if (Swapped)
     std::swap(Locs.first, Locs.second);
Index: llvm/include/llvm/Analysis/AliasAnalysis.h
===================================================================
--- llvm/include/llvm/Analysis/AliasAnalysis.h
+++ llvm/include/llvm/Analysis/AliasAnalysis.h
@@ -189,24 +189,30 @@
   void removeInstruction(Instruction *I);
 };
 
-/// Reduced version of MemoryLocation that only stores a pointer and size.
-/// Used for caching AATags independent BasicAA results.
+/// Cache key for BasicAA results. It only includes the pointer and size from
+/// MemoryLocation, as BasicAA is AATags independent. Additionally, it includes
+/// the value of MayBeCrossIteration, which may affect BasicAA results.
 struct AACacheLoc {
-  const Value *Ptr;
+  using PtrTy = PointerIntPair<const Value *, 1, bool>;
+  PtrTy Ptr;
   LocationSize Size;
+
+  AACacheLoc(PtrTy Ptr, LocationSize Size) : Ptr(Ptr), Size(Size) {}
+  AACacheLoc(const Value *Ptr, LocationSize Size, bool MayBeCrossIteration)
+      : Ptr(Ptr, MayBeCrossIteration), Size(Size) {}
 };
 
 template <> struct DenseMapInfo<AACacheLoc> {
   static inline AACacheLoc getEmptyKey() {
-    return {DenseMapInfo<const Value *>::getEmptyKey(),
+    return {DenseMapInfo<AACacheLoc::PtrTy>::getEmptyKey(),
             DenseMapInfo<LocationSize>::getEmptyKey()};
   }
   static inline AACacheLoc getTombstoneKey() {
-    return {DenseMapInfo<const Value *>::getTombstoneKey(),
+    return {DenseMapInfo<AACacheLoc::PtrTy>::getTombstoneKey(),
             DenseMapInfo<LocationSize>::getTombstoneKey()};
   }
   static unsigned getHashValue(const AACacheLoc &Val) {
-    return DenseMapInfo<const Value *>::getHashValue(Val.Ptr) ^
+    return DenseMapInfo<AACacheLoc::PtrTy>::getHashValue(Val.Ptr) ^
            DenseMapInfo<LocationSize>::getHashValue(Val.Size);
   }
   static bool isEqual(const AACacheLoc &LHS, const AACacheLoc &RHS) {
@@ -257,15 +263,6 @@
   SmallVector<AAQueryInfo::LocPair, 4> AssumptionBasedResults;
 
   AAQueryInfo(AAResults &AAR, CaptureInfo *CI) : AAR(AAR), CI(CI) {}
-
-  /// Create a new AAQueryInfo based on this one, but with the cache cleared.
-  /// This is used for recursive queries across phis, where cache results may
-  /// not be valid.
-  AAQueryInfo withEmptyCache() {
-    AAQueryInfo NewAAQI(AAR, CI);
-    NewAAQI.Depth = Depth;
-    return NewAAQI;
-  }
 };
